The Sales Analyst is responsible for the day-to-day execution of CRM hygiene, data integrity, and serves as a backup to frontline operational support for the Sales organization. This role assumes ownership of CRM cleanliness and operational enforcement, allowing the Sales Operations Manager to focus on broader tooling, cross-functional initiatives, and project leadership.

This role is highly operational and execution-focused, with a strong emphasis on data quality, process adherence, issue resolution, and responsiveness to Sales needs.

Core Responsibilities

1. CRM Hygiene & Data Integrity (Primary Focus)

This role takes over day-to-day ownership of CRM hygiene and enforcement from the Sales Operations Manager.

-
Own CRM data quality standards across all Sales-facing objects.

-
Execute daily, weekly, and monthly hygiene routines to ensure data accuracy and consistency.

- Enforce expectations for:

- Required fields and field completeness

-
Opportunity stage progression and close-date accuracy

- Account and hierarchy usage

-
Activity logging and basic usage standards

- Identify, triage, and remediate:

- Duplicate records

-
Orphaned accounts, contacts, and opportunities

- Stale or inactive pipeline

-
Incomplete, conflicting, or inconsistent data entries

-
Partner with Sales leadership and Sales Operations Manager to reinforce accountability for CRM usage and compliance.

-
Serve as the operational owner for CRM cleanliness, escalating systemic issues or automation gaps to the Sales Operations Manager and IT as needed.

-
Maintain and distribute standard Salesforce reports and dashboards to provide operational visibility (non-analytics, non‑predictive).

2. Sales Help Desk & Frontline Support (Shared Responsibility)

This role provides tier ‑ 1 and tier ‑ 2 support for Sales in partnership with the Sales Operations Manager.

-
Act as a first point of contact for Sales-related operational questions and issues, particularly during U.S. off-hours.

-
Support Salesforce and tool usage questions including:

- Access issues

- Routing errors

- Workflow confusion

- Basic reporting requests

-
Triage incoming issues and determine whether they can be resolved operationally or require escalation.

-
Document issues clearly and escalate to the Sales Operations Manager or IT with strong business context.

-
Maintain FAQs, internal documentation, and repeatable guidance to reduce recurring help desk volume.

-
Follow established escalation and support processes when technical intervention is required.

3. Process Execution & Operational Support

-
Support execution of Sales Operations processes such as:

- Pipeline reviews

- Deal hygiene checks

- Territory or account updates

- Tool and process rollouts

-
Execute defined operational playbooks and recurring processes with consistency.

-
Assist the Sales Operations Manager in operational projects by owning defined workstreams or execution tasks.

-
Monitor adherence to Sales processes and surface gaps or breakdowns proactively.

-
Provide feedback from frontline execution that informs process improvement and tooling decisions.

Ideal Background

-
2–5+ years of experience in Sales Operations, Business Operations, or CRM-focused analyst roles.

-
Strong hands-on experience working in Salesforce in a Sales environment.

-
High attention to detail and comfort working in data-heavy workflows.

-
Experience supporting frontline Sales teams in a help-desk or enablement capacity.

-
Comfortable following defined processes with consistency and discipline.

-
Strong written communication skills and ability to work effectively across time zones.
